如何在不删除账户的情况下屏蔽WordPress用户

11/16/2022

何时不应删除用户账户

删除用户账户虽然简单,但会导致需要将他们的内容分配给其他用户,这会改变文章的作者信息。修改用户的密码和邮箱地址也能阻止他们登录,但也会更改他们的Gravatar头像。在多作者博客、论坛或社区网站上,有时您可能需要禁用用户账户而非删除。

方法一:通过降级用户角色来屏蔽用户

将用户角色降级为Subscriber

您可以将用户的角色降级为Subscriber。这将限制他们只能修改个人设置,例如名字和管理颜色方案。但这对于已撰写文章的用户来说,可能会成为问题,例如他们可以将名字改为冒犯性内容,并显示在他们所有的文章上。

将用户角色降级为“No role for this site”

更好的选择是降级用户角色为“No role for this site”。他们将无法进入管理区域,如果尝试导航,将会显示无访问权限的错误信息。首先,前往Users » All Users页面,点击想要屏蔽的用户旁边的“Edit”链接。然后,在Role设置中选择“No role for this site”,点击“Update User”按钮保存设置。

方法二:使用“Lock User Account”插件屏蔽用户

“Lock User Account”是一款轻量级插件,用于阻止用户登录。首先安装该插件,然后导航至Users » All Users页面,勾选想要屏蔽的用户旁边的复选框,点击“Bulk actions”按钮,选择“Lock”,最后点击“Apply”按钮。若要解除屏蔽,重复上述步骤选择“Unlock”。在Settings » General 页面,可以自定义屏蔽信息。

方法三:在特定日期或时间屏蔽用户

使用“User Blocker”插件,可以在特定时间内屏蔽用户或允许某些用户仅在工作时间登录。安装并激活插件后,导航至User Blocker页面,可以选择按时间或日期屏蔽。选择“Block User By Time”标签,勾选要屏蔽的用户或角色,在Block Time部分设置要屏蔽的时间段,并点击“Block User”按钮保存设置。选择“Block User By Date”标签,可以设置特定日期范围内屏蔽用户。若永久屏蔽某用户,选择“Block User Permanent”标签,设置相关信息并保存。

总结

希望本教程能帮助您了解如何在不删除账户的情况下屏蔽WordPress用户。您还可以查看我们的终极WordPress安全指南或推荐的最佳WordPress安全插件。



Related Posts

  • 2025-01-31
  • WordPress 插件

通知评论者他们的评论已获批准是在您的网站上鼓励对话的简单而有效的方法。然而,WordPress 默认情况下不会在评论发布时通知用户,这可能导致他们对评论的状态感到困惑。有许多网站拥有者问我们如何解决此问题,因此我们编写了这篇指南来帮助您!在这篇文章中,我们将展示如何轻松通知用户他们的评论已在 WordPress 中被批准,以保持互动积极并吸引更多观众参与。

閱讀更多
  • 2025-01-31
  • WordPress 插件

想知道我们在 WPressize Me 如何通过添加标题属性和 nofollow 标签来改善用户体验和SEO吗?默认的 WordPress 编辑器并不容易提供这些选项。本文将为您简要介绍如何在 WordPress 的插入链接弹出窗口中为链接添加标题和 nofollow 属性选项,以便简化工作流程和提升您的SEO努力。

閱讀更多
  • 2025-01-28
  • WordPress 插件

你是否想在你的WordPress网站上启用Imagick?大多数情况,WordPress会自动使用Imagick来管理所有网站的图像。然而,通过调整默认的Imagick设置,你可以提高网站性能或向访客展示更高质量的图像。在本文中,我们将展示如何在你的WordPress网站上启用Imagick,并自定义其设置以改善访客体验。

閱讀更多

{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}
>